So back to the eating of the eggs. Â Nothing drives me battier than getting bits of eggshell in my eggs. Â And trying to get it out with my finger just makes me even battier… like my head is a belfry full of them.
So, I figured out this little trick, and it totally works.
When you get a piece of shell in your eggs like this:
Just take another piece of eggshell like this:
And pull it out! Â It will stick to the eggshell right away, and out it comes.
